  • While software globalization is becoming more important, little research has been undertaken into what is meant by globalization and the degree of globalization capability in the Korean software industry. A survey study was conducted among software engineering professionals, gathering the data from 31 IT companies across 7 large-scale projects in Korea. The results indicate that the evaluation score for globalization capability is 2.51 out of 5 points, which is the lowest compared to other areas of software engineering such as team capability (2.88), process and tool supports (2.96), project management (2.97) and development (3.64). We also discuss how to introduce software globalization technologies in Korea based on the successful experiences of leading global IT companies.

  • This study focuses primarily on the construction of the wartime sealift operation model from US to Korea. There are some uncertainties in the process of sealift operation such as the procurement rate of materiel in US, the distribution of KFS on four initial position locations at the start of the activation, and the number of ports and berths in the SPOES and SPODS. The sealift capability, based on the allocation of sealift assets such as the number of vessels, berths, and ports, is evaluated through simulation. The simulation is executed with a baseline wartime scenario and then the results are analyzed through a sensitivity analysis. The military planner may use of this model as a standard for establishing effective and concrete sealift operation plan in the near future.

  • In manufacture of printed circuit boards, one important issue is precisely to measure the three-dimensional shape of the solder paste silk-screened prior to direct surface mounting of chips. This paper presents the 3D shape reconstruction of solder paste using the optical triangulation method based on structured light or slit beam and the measurement algorithm for height, volume. area, and coplanarity on component pads from the 3D range image. Futhermore, statistical process control function is incorporated for process capability analysis.

  • 6 sigma movement is the most prominent quality improvement methodology in practice. Measurement plays an important role in helping any organization improve quality. Therefore, the measurement systems analysis is the first step for the quality improvement of manufacturing process in 6 sigma movement. In this study, we investigate the effect of Gage Repeatability and Reproducibility(Gage R&R) in view of defect rate and process capability indices, and provide guidelines for acceptance of gage repeatability and reproducibility(%R&R) for six sigma quality.

  • Finite element analysis is carried out for simulation of the multi-stage elliptic cup drawing process with the large aspect ratio. The analysis incorporates with shell elements for an elasto-plastic finite element method with the explicit time integration scheme. For the simulation, LS-DYNA3D is utilized for its wide capability of solving forming problems. The simulation result shows that the non-uniform drawing ratio at the elliptic cross section ad the small shoulder radius cause failure such as tearing and wrinkling. The result suggests the guideline to modify the tool shape for prevention of the failure during the drawing process.
